When choosing science kits, focus on the diversity of experiments, quality of materials, and safety features. Avoid kits with limited activities or fragile components that may not withstand multiple uses. Ensure that instructions are clear, age-appropriate, and include safety guidelines.

Another key consideration is whether the kit aligns with your educational goals—look for those that encourage critical thinking, hypothesis testing, and observation. Storage options for components are also important so that the kit remains organized and ready for future experiments. Investing in a well-rounded science kit can foster a love of discovery and reinforce classroom lessons through practical application. Remember, the best kits are those that balance fun with educational rigor, providing a memorable learning experience.

The Amazon Fire HD 10 Kids Pro tablet features a bright 10.1-inch HD display, robust parental controls, and a 13-hour battery life, making it suitable for children aged 6-12. It includes a kid-proof case, a 1-year subscription to Amazon Kids+, and is designed for safe, educational, and entertainment use.
